SaqqaraSaqqara Necropolis is the vast ancient cemetery of Memphis, the first capital of ancient Egypt. It was used as a royal and elite burial ground for over 3,000 years. The site is best known for the Step Pyramid of Djoser, designed by Imhotep, which is considered the world's oldest large stone monument. Saqqara contains numerous pyramids, tombs, and temples decorated with colorful scenes of daily life, making it one of the richest archaeological sites for understanding ancient Egyptian history, religion, and architecture.

Dahshur is a royal necropolis located south of Saqqara and is famous for its well-preserved pyramids. It contains the Bent Pyramid and the Red Pyramid, both built by Pharaoh Sneferu during the 4th Dynasty. The Bent Pyramid is unique because its angle changes halfway up, while the Red Pyramid is considered the first successful true smooth-sided pyramid. Dahshur played a crucial role in the development of pyramid construction and helped pave the way for the famous pyramids of Giza.

Mit Rahina MuseumMemphis Open-Air Museum is located on the site of ancient Memphis, the first capital of Egypt. The museum displays important monuments discovered in the area, including the colossal statue of Ramesses II and the famous Alabaster Sphinx. The museum offers visitors a glimpse into the grandeur of ancient Memphis and its role as Egypt's political and religious center for many centuries.
